Công cụ Kiểm thử API

Công cụ Kiểm thử API Tốt nhấtnăm 2026 — Đã Đánh giá.

Chúng tôi đã kiểm thử 6 nền tảng kiểm thử API phổ biến nhất để bạn không phải làm điều đó. Từ kiểm thử chức năng đơn giản đến kiểm thử tải doanh nghiệp, đây là mọi thứ bạn cần để chọn đúng công cụ.

6 Công cụ Đã So sánhChức năng & Hiệu năngPhân tích Gói Miễn phíTích hợp CI/CD

6 Công cụ Kiểm thử API Tốt nhất

Đánh giá chuyên sâu từng nền tảng — bao gồm khả năng cốt lõi, ảnh chụp màn hình thực tế, giá cả và ưu nhược điểm trung thực.

Apidog

Visit Site →
Giao diện trình xây dựng kiểm thử API trực quan của Apidog

Apidog là nền tảng phát triển API thống nhất bao gồm thiết kế, debug, kiểm thử, mock và tài liệu trong một không gian làm việc duy nhất. Không giống như các công cụ kiểm thử độc lập, Apidog giữ cho các trường hợp kiểm thử của bạn tự động đồng bộ với đặc tả API — vì vậy khi bạn cập nhật một endpoint, các bài kiểm thử vẫn hợp lệ mà không cần nỗ lực thủ công. Với trình xây dựng kiểm thử trực quan, kiểm thử hiệu năng tích hợp và gói miễn phí hào phóng cho nhóm, Apidog là công cụ duy nhất trong danh sách này loại bỏ nhu cầu về một client API riêng biệt, máy chủ mock và trình tạo tài liệu.

Pros

  • Các trường hợp kiểm thử tự động đồng bộ khi đặc tả API thay đổi
  • Điều phối kiểm thử trực quan — không cần script
  • Kiểm thử hiệu năng (tải) tích hợp sẵn
  • Gói miễn phí hào phóng: lên đến 4 người dùng, không giới hạn lần chạy
  • Tùy chọn triển khai On-premises và lưu trú tại EU
  • Thiết kế API, mock và tài liệu tất cả trong một công cụ

Cons

  • Thương hiệu mới hơn — cộng đồng nhỏ hơn Postman
  • Script nâng cao yêu cầu học JS API của Apidog
Best for: Các nhóm muốn quy trình thiết kế-đến-kiểm thử thống nhất mà không cần quản lý nhiều công cụ
Miễn phí (lên đến 4 người dùng). Trả phí từ $9/người dùng/tháng.

Postman

Visit Site →
Giao diện kiểm thử API của Postman

Postman là công cụ API được nhận diện rộng rãi nhất thế giới, được sử dụng bởi hàng triệu nhà phát triển để gửi request và chạy các bài kiểm thử dựa trên collection. Newman CLI cho phép tích hợp CI/CD cơ bản. Tuy nhiên, khả năng kiểm thử của Postman chủ yếu dựa trên script (JavaScript), và nó thiếu trình xây dựng kiểm thử trực quan, đồng bộ hóa thiết kế-kiểm thử API gốc và kiểm thử hiệu năng tích hợp. Ở quy mô lớn, giá cả trở thành một vấn đề đáng kể — hợp tác nhóm yêu cầu gói trả phí, và các tính năng doanh nghiệp đắt hơn đáng kể so với các giải pháp thay thế mới hơn.

Pros

  • Cộng đồng và hệ sinh thái khổng lồ
  • Tích hợp bên thứ ba phong phú
  • Newman CLI cho pipeline CI/CD
  • Giao diện quen thuộc với hầu hết nhà phát triển API

Cons

  • Không có trình xây dựng kiểm thử trực quan — yêu cầu kiến thức script
  • Gói miễn phí giới hạn 1 người dùng (không có hợp tác nhóm)
  • Không có thiết kế API hoặc kiểm thử hiệu năng tích hợp
  • Đắt ở quy mô lớn: $14/người dùng/tháng cho tính năng nhóm cơ bản
Best for: Các nhà phát triển cá nhân hoặc nhóm đã đầu tư sâu vào hệ sinh thái Postman
Miễn phí (chỉ 1 người dùng). Nhóm từ $14/người dùng/tháng.

ReadyAPI

Visit Site →
Giao diện kiểm thử doanh nghiệp của ReadyAPI

ReadyAPI (trước đây là SoapUI Pro) là nền tảng kiểm thử API doanh nghiệp của SmartBear. Nó hỗ trợ nhiều giao thức bao gồm SOAP, REST và GraphQL, đồng thời cung cấp các tính năng nâng cao như kiểm thử hướng dữ liệu, quét bảo mật và kiểm thử tải thông qua thành phần LoadUI tích hợp. ReadyAPI xuất sắc trong môi trường doanh nghiệp tuân thủ quy định nơi cần báo cáo kiểm thử toàn diện và audit trail. Đánh đổi là đường cong học tập dốc, giao diện người dùng lỗi thời và mức giá nằm trong số cao nhất trong danh mục — khiến nó không phù hợp với các nhóm agile hiện đại.

Pros

  • Bộ tính năng kiểm thử doanh nghiệp toàn diện
  • Hỗ trợ SOAP và XML mạnh mẽ
  • Kiểm thử tải tích hợp qua LoadUI
  • Báo cáo kiểm thử chi tiết cho tuân thủ/audit

Cons

  • Rất đắt: ~$1,170+/người dùng/năm
  • UI lỗi thời với đường cong học tập dốc
  • Quá mức cho các quy trình làm việc chỉ REST/GraphQL
  • Yêu cầu thiết lập và cấu hình đáng kể
Best for: Các doanh nghiệp lớn với yêu cầu tuân thủ nghiêm ngặt và API SOAP/XML遗留
Từ ~$1,170/người dùng/năm (không có gói miễn phí đáng kể).

Katalon

Visit Site →
Giao diện tự động hóa kiểm thử Katalon Studio

Katalon là nền tảng tự động hóa kiểm thử chuyên dụng xử lý cả kiểm thử API và UI web/mobile trong một công cụ duy nhất. Nó có trình xây dựng kiểm thử không cần mã cho các nhóm QA thích tạo kiểm thử bằng thao tác click, cũng như kiểm thử dựa trên script cho người dùng nâng cao. Katalon tích hợp với các hệ thống CI/CD phổ biến và hỗ trợ BDD (cú pháp Gherkin). Mặc dù đây là lựa chọn mạnh mẽ cho các nhóm kiểm thử cả API và giao diện người dùng, nhưng nó gây ra chi phí đáng kể cho các nhóm chỉ cần kiểm thử API — và gói miễn phí của nó có những hạn chế đáng kể về mức sử dụng.

Pros

  • Kết hợp tự động hóa kiểm thử API và UI (web/mobile)
  • Tạo kiểm thử không cần mã cho người không phải lập trình viên
  • Hỗ trợ BDD/Gherkin ngay từ hộp
  • Tích hợp CI/CD và JIRA tốt

Cons

  • Nền tảng nặng — thiết lập phức tạp cho các trường hợp sử dụng chỉ API
  • Gói miễn phí giới hạn tính năng cơ bản và phút chạy
  • Chạy chậm hơn các công cụ kiểm thử API chuyên dụng
  • Di sản tập trung vào UI có thể cảm thấy như gánh nặng cho các nhóm API
Best for: Các nhóm QA chịu trách nhiệm cho cả tự động hóa kiểm thử API và UI web/mobile
Có gói miễn phí. Trả phí từ $208/năm.

k6

Visit Site →
Bảng điều khiển kết quả kiểm thử hiệu năng k6

k6 (của Grafana) là công cụ kiểm thử hiệu năng và tải mã nguồn mở sử dụng API script JavaScript sạch. Nó được thiết kế cho các nhà phát triển muốn viết kiểm thử hiệu năng như mã và tích hợp chúng trực tiếp vào pipeline CI/CD. k6 xuất sắc trong việc mô phỏng tải người dùng đồng thời cao, đo thời gian response và phát hiện hồi quy hiệu năng. Tuy nhiên, nó là công cụ chuyên dụng tập trung độc quyền vào hiệu năng — nó không có GUI, không có trình tạo assertion chức năng và không có khả năng thiết kế API. Các nhóm cần cả kiểm thử chức năng và hiệu năng sẽ cần kết hợp k6 với một công cụ khác.

Pros

  • Khả năng kiểm thử hiệu năng và tải xuất sắc
  • API JavaScript sạch — dễ tiếp nhận cho nhà phát triển
  • Mã nguồn mở và miễn phí khi tự lưu trữ
  • Tích hợp gốc với dashboard Grafana

Cons

  • Chỉ dùng mã — không có GUI trực quan để tạo kiểm thử
  • Không có tính năng kiểm thử API chức năng (assertion, mock)
  • Không có không gian làm việc thiết kế hoặc hợp tác API
  • Thực thi cloud dựa trên mức sử dụng và có thể trở nên đắt đỏ
Best for: Các nhà phát triển và nhóm DevOps tập trung vào kiểm thử hiệu năng, tải và stress
Mã nguồn mở (miễn phí). Grafana Cloud k6 từ $49/tháng.

Apache JMeter

Visit Site →
Giao diện kiểm thử tải Apache JMeter

Apache JMeter là công cụ mã nguồn mở lâu đời, ban đầu được thiết kế để kiểm thử tải ứng dụng web và API. Nó hỗ trợ nhiều giao thức (HTTP, SOAP, FTP, JDBC và nhiều hơn nữa) và có hệ sinh thái plugin khổng lồ. JMeter miễn phí và có khả năng mở rộng cao, khiến nó trở thành lựa chọn phổ biến cho các nhóm có ngân sách hạn chế. Tuy nhiên, mô hình cấu hình dựa trên XML lỗi thời, GUI phức tạp và thiếu công thái học nhà phát triển hiện đại khiến việc tiếp nhận khó khăn cho các nhóm mới. Các bài kiểm thử JMeter (tệp JMX) nổi tiếng khó kiểm soát phiên bản và bảo trì.

Pros

  • Hoàn toàn miễn phí và mã nguồn mở
  • Rất trưởng thành với hệ sinh thái plugin phong phú
  • Hỗ trợ nhiều giao thức ngoài HTTP
  • Khả năng kiểm thử tải và stress mạnh mẽ

Cons

  • Cấu hình dựa trên XML lỗi thời, phức tạp
  • Đường cong học tập dốc cho người dùng mới
  • Không có tính năng thiết kế API, mock hoặc tài liệu
  • Tệp kiểm thử JMX khó kiểm soát phiên bản và xem xét
Best for: Các nhóm cần kiểm thử tải miễn phí, có khả năng tùy chỉnh sâu với chuyên môn JMeter hiện có
Mã nguồn mở (miễn phí).

So sánh Tính năng: 6 Công cụ Kiểm thử API

Bảng tính năng song song để giúp bạn đánh giá công cụ nào phù hợp với quy trình làm việc của mình.

Features
Postman
ReadyAPI
Katalon
k6
JMeter
Giao thức & Loại Kiểm thử Được hỗ trợ
HTTP / REST
GraphQLPartialPartial
gRPC
WebSocket
SOAP / XML
Tự động hóa Kiểm thử
Trình xây dựng kiểm thử trực quan (không cần mã)
Kiểm thử hướng dữ liệu
Tích hợp CI/CD
Chạy kiểm thử theo lịch
Runner tự lưu trữ
Assertion & Báo cáo
Assertion trực quan (không cần mã)
Assertion dựa trên scriptLimited
Xác thực Schema / JSON
Báo cáo kiểm thử trực tuyếnPluginPlugin
Kiểm thử Hiệu năng
Kiểm thử tải
Mô phỏng người dùng đồng thời
Thiết kế & Mock API
Thiết kế & đặc tả API (OpenAPI)
Máy chủ mock
Tự động đồng bộ đặc tả ↔ trường hợp kiểm thửPartial
Giá cả & Triển khai
Gói miễn phíUp to 4 Users1 UserTrial OnlyLimitedOpen SourceOpen Source
On-Premises / Tự lưu trữCLI OnlyN/A

Tại sao Các nhóm Kỹ thuật Chọn Apidog

Apidog là công cụ kiểm thử API duy nhất kết nối mọi giai đoạn của vòng đời API — thiết kế, kiểm thử, mock và tài liệu — trong một không gian làm việc đồng bộ duy nhất.

1

Kiểm thử Giữ Đồng bộ với Đặc tả API của Bạn

Khi bạn cập nhật một endpoint API trong Apidog, các trường hợp kiểm thử của bạn tự động phản ánh thay đổi. Không còn kiểm thử hỏng sau khi tái cấu trúc. Không công cụ nào khác trong danh sách này cung cấp điều này.

2

Trình xây dựng Kiểm thử Trực quan — Không cần Script

Xây dựng các kịch bản kiểm thử nhiều bước phức tạp với assertion, trích xuất dữ liệu và logic điều kiện sử dụng giao diện kéo-thả. Phân phối chất lượng nhanh hơn mà không cần viết mã kiểm thử.

3

Kiểm thử Hiệu năng Tích hợp Sẵn

Chạy kiểm thử tải với số người dùng đồng thời có thể cấu hình trực tiếp từ collection API hiện có của bạn. Không cần script k6 riêng biệt hay kế hoạch JMeter để bảo trì.

4

Gói Miễn phí Hào phóng cho Nhóm

Lên đến 4 thành viên nhóm có thể hợp tác với unlimited cuộc gọi API, chạy collection và dự án — miễn phí. Postman giới hạn gói miễn phí cho một người dùng duy nhất.

5

CI/CD với Runner Tự lưu trữ

Chạy bộ kiểm thử Apidog của bạn trong bất kỳ pipeline CI/CD nào (GitHub Actions, Jenkins, GitLab CI) sử dụng CLI hoặc runner tự lưu trữ. Không có lo ngại về nơi lưu trú dữ liệu đám mây.

6

Mock, Thiết kế và Kiểm thử trong Một Tab

Ngừng chuyển đổi giữa Postman, Stoplight và một công cụ mock riêng biệt. Apidog cung cấp máy chủ mock thông minh, thiết kế API trực quan và kiểm thử tự động tất cả trong một nền tảng.

#1 Phần mềm phát triển API dễ sử dụng nhất

Được xếp hạng bởi người dùng thực trên G2, nền tảng đánh giá phần mềm B2B số 1 thế giới.

#1Apidog
9.4
Điểm khả năng sử dụng
Dễ quản trị9.8
Trung bình danh mục: 9.0
Dễ sử dụng9.7
Trung bình danh mục: 9.0
Đáp ứng yêu cầu9.7
Trung bình danh mục: 9.1
G2 Badge
G2 Badge
G2 Badge
G2 Badge
G2 Best Software
G2 Badge
G2 Badge
G2 Badge
G2 Badge

Câu hỏi Thường gặp

Sẵn sàng Kiểm thử API đúng Cách?

Tham gia cùng hơn 1 triệu nhà phát triển sử dụng Apidog cho thiết kế, kiểm thử, mock và tài liệu.